The New Terminal One at JFK Announces RFP for Loose Furniture, Fixtures, and Equipment (FF&E) Installation for CBP and TSA Spaces

Press Release Provided by The New Terminal One

July 1, 2024

JAMAICA, N.Y., July 1, 2024 /PRNewswire/ — Committed to ensuring a seamless, state-of-the-art passenger experience when operations begin in 2026, the New Terminal One at New York John F. Kennedy International Airport has launched a request for proposals (RFP) from providers for the furnishing and installation services of loose furniture, fixtures, and equipment (FF&E) for Customs and Border Patrol (CBP) and Transportation Safety Administration (TSA) spaces in the terminal.

The New Terminal One invites qualified firms to submit proposals for the provision and commission of FF&E for specialized CBP and TSA spaces within the new terminal. These spaces are crucial to ensuring the safety and security of passengers and will be integral to the terminal’s operations…
